3.5.30.2 NAVSTAT Operation
This operation indicates on the LCD display the position information that
has been input through NMEA or SeaTalk.
1) Press the FUNC key followed by the MENU key to initiate the Menu
operation.
2) Select NAVSTAT and press the ENT key. Scroll through the following
five items with the SQ UP/DOWN key, or wait as they are automatically
displayed at 3-second intervals in the following order:
This data is for viewing only and can not be altered. Manual position entry
is done in the DSC menu as outlined in Section 3.5.30.3.2
To return to the main menu screen, again press FUNC followed by MENU.
To exit the Menu operation, press and hold the CLR key for 3 seconds.
1. Latitude
2. Longitude
3. UTC Time

4. UTC Data (Y/M/D)
5. Position source (GPS, LORAN, etc.)
